Izzah Binti Amzan (born 19 October 2000) is a Malaysian rhythmic gymnast.
Athletic career
Izzah made her international senior debut in 2016.[3] She represented Malaysia at the 2017 Southeast Asian Games and at age 17 became one of Malaysia’s youngest athletes to compete at the SEA Games.[4] At the 2019 Southeast Asian Games, she won two gold medals and one silver.[5] She was selected to represent Malaysia at the 2022 Commonwealth Games and won a bronze medal in the individual clubs event and finishing fourth in both the team all-around and individual all-around competitions.[6]
